Ingredients List for Roasted Parmesan Asparagus
- 1 pound fresh asparagus
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1/4 teaspoon kosher salt
- 1/4 teaspoon ground black pepper
- 2 tablespoons grated parmesan cheese
- The juice of 1 lemon – about 1 tablespoon
- Red pepper flakes – optional for serving
How To Make Roasted Parmesan Asparagus Step-by-Step
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Preheat your oven to 425 degrees F and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
Step 2: Prep the Asparagus
Rinse and dry the asparagus with paper towels. Trim the ends to remove the woodsy part of the stems. To do this, gather the asparagus and use a sharp kitchen knife to cut about an inch from the bottom of each spear.
Step 3: Season
Lay the asparagus spears in a single layer on the prepared baking sheet. Drizzle them with olive oil and season with a pinch of salt and pepper. Toss the asparagus to make sure each spear is well coated. Then, sprinkle the grated parmesan cheese evenly over the asparagus.
Step 4: Roast
Place the baking sheet in the oven and roast the asparagus at 425 degrees F for about 10 minutes, or until they are fork-tender.
Step 5: Serve
Once the asparagus is cooked, remove it from the oven. Squeeze fresh lemon juice over the spears and add a pinch of red pepper flakes if you desire some heat. Enjoy the irresistible flavor!

Chef’s Notes & Pro Tips About Roasted Parmesan Asparagus
- Choose Fresh Asparagus: Look for bright green asparagus with firm, straight spears. Avoid any that are limp or have dark spots.
- Don’t Overcrowd the Pan: Make sure the asparagus is in a single layer on the baking sheet. This helps them roast evenly and become nice and crispy.
- Experiment with Cheese: While parmesan tastes wonderful, feel free to try other cheeses like pecorino romano or even a sprinkle of feta for a different flavor.
- Add Herbs or Spices: Consider adding garlic powder, Italian seasoning, or fresh herbs for an extra layer of flavor.

Tips For Success
- Watch the Time: Keep an eye on the asparagus as it roasts to avoid overcooking. Each oven is different, so timing may vary slightly.
- Use Quality Olive Oil: A good quality olive oil will enhance the flavor of the asparagus.
- Try Blanching First: If you prefer a more vibrant color, briefly blanch the asparagus in boiling water before roasting.

How To Store Roasted Parmesan Asparagus
- Refrigerate Promptly: Cool the roasted asparagus to room temperature, then store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ator.
- Consume Within 2-3 Days: For the best flavor and texture, enjoy leftovers within a few days.
- Reheat Gently: When reheating, do so in the oven for a few minutes to retain crispness, or quickly microwave on low power if you’re in a hurry.
- Avoid Freezing: Freezing is not recommended, as it can ruin the texture of the asparagus.
- Use in Other Dishes: Add leftover asparagus to omelets, quiches, or grain bowls for a quick meal.
FAQs About Roasted Parmesan Asparagus
Can I use frozen asparagus?
Yes, but note that the texture may differ. Adjust roasting time accordingly.Can I make this ahead of time?
Yes, you can prepare the asparagus and season it ahead, then roast it just before serving.What if I don’t have parmesan cheese?
You can substitute with any hard cheese or even omit it for a dairy-free version.How do I make it gluten-free?
This recipe is inherently gluten-free. Just ensure that any cheese used is also gluten-free.
